Staff Machine Learning Engineer, Product Catalog

PayPal
San Jose, California2026-04-29Full time

About the job

Join PayPal's Consumer Product Catalog and Search team building next-generation product discovery for millions of global shoppers. As a Machine Learning Engineer, you'll develop indexing pipelines and query-time services delivering fast, relevant search results. Collaborate with backend engineers and catalog data teams to enable intelligent, scalable search capabilities.

Responsibilities

Lead the development and optimization of advanced machine learning models.

Oversee the preprocessing and analysis of large datasets.

Deploy and maintain ML solutions in production environments.

Collaborate with cross-functional teams to integrate ML models into products and services.

Monitor and evaluate the performance of deployed models, making necessary adjustments.

Qualifications

Minimum

5+ years relevant experience and a Bachelor’s degree OR Any equivalent combination of education and experience.

Extensive experience with ML frameworks like TensorFlow, PyTorch, or scikit-learn.

Expertise in cloud platforms (AWS, Azure, GCP) and tools for data processing and model deployment.

Preferred

8+ years of industry experience with deep learning architectures, building, fine-tuning and deploying ML models in production.

Strong proficiency in Python, Scala, or other programming languages.

Experience working with large datasets, data processing pipelines (e.g., Dataflow, Spark, Flink), and scalable architectures.

Strong communication and collaboration skills, with the ability to work effectively across teams and contribute to a high-performing engineering culture.

Experience working on search or recommendation systems at scale.

Familiarity with A/B testing and experimentation methodologies for search relevance improvement.